How to customize rotating isp plans based on business needs

PYPROXY PYPROXY · Nov 12, 2025

In today’s fast-evolving digital landscape, businesses of all sizes depend heavily on reliable internet service providers (ISPs) to ensure smooth operations. One of the most effective ways to manage internet costs while ensuring optimal performance is by customizing rotating ISP plans according to specific business needs. A rotating ISP plan allows businesses to dynamically switch between different service packages or bandwidth allocations based on usage patterns, peak demand periods, or project-based requirements. This approach offers a cost-efficient solution that balances performance and cost-effectiveness, making it a valuable strategy for businesses seeking flexibility in their internet services.

Understanding Rotating ISP Plans

Rotating ISP plans are flexible and adaptive internet service packages that businesses can switch between based on predefined criteria. These plans offer a range of benefits that can be aligned with the varying demands of different business functions. Unlike static ISP packages that lock customers into a fixed bandwidth or service model, rotating plans provide businesses with the ability to adjust their service level according to real-time requirements. The customization aspect is crucial because it allows businesses to tailor their plans to match peak demand periods, project-based needs, or fluctuations in data usage.

Businesses that frequently experience fluctuations in internet traffic, such as e-commerce companies, content providers, or organizations with multiple remote offices, find rotating ISP plans particularly beneficial. For example, an e-commerce platform may experience higher traffic during sales events and promotions, requiring increased bandwidth. With a rotating plan, the ISP service can automatically adjust to meet this surge in demand, ensuring uninterrupted service.

Why Customization Matters for Businesses

Customizing a rotating ISP plan according to business needs provides several advantages. The most significant of these is the ability to avoid overpaying for unused bandwidth or services. Many traditional ISP packages force businesses to pay for a certain level of service that they may not need all the time. Customization offers a solution by allowing businesses to pay for only what they use, thus optimizing cost efficiency.

Another key benefit of customization is enhanced performance during critical periods. With a dynamic plan, businesses can allocate more bandwidth during peak usage times, such as product launches, marketing campaigns, or customer support surges. This ensures that essential business operations, such as website performance and communication channels, remain seamless and reliable, preventing costly downtimes that can negatively affect customer experience and revenue.

Steps to Customize Rotating ISP Plans Based on Business Needs

1. Assess Your Business Internet Usage Patterns

The first step in customizing an ISP plan is to analyze your business’s internet usage patterns. Understanding how and when bandwidth is utilized will help you determine the most appropriate rotating plan. For example, if your business operates in a region where there is heavy traffic during certain seasons, or if you have specific projects that require high data usage, you can tailor the ISP plan to meet these needs.

2. Identify Peak and Off-Peak Hours

Once you’ve assessed your business’s usage patterns, identifying peak and off-peak hours is crucial. Peak hours typically coincide with high-demand periods when employees or customers are using internet services intensively, such as during product launches or customer support operations. Off-peak hours may occur late at night or during weekends when internet usage is minimal. By identifying these periods, you can adjust your ISP plan to provide maximum bandwidth during high-demand times and scale it down during off-peak hours to optimize costs.

3. Understand Your Business Functions and Their Specific Needs

Different departments and functions within your business may have different internet requirements. For instance, the marketing department might require additional bandwidth during promotional campaigns, while the accounting department might have minimal requirements throughout the year. Understanding these specific needs allows you to allocate resources appropriately within your rotating ISP plan. A customized plan ensures that each department gets the service it needs without overpaying for resources that go unused.

4. Negotiate with Your ISP for Tailored Packages

Once you have a clear understanding of your business's needs, it’s time to negotiate with your ISP to tailor a rotating plan. Many ISPs offer customized solutions that allow businesses to adjust their service plans based on specific usage scenarios. Some ISPs offer flexible contract terms and the ability to change service packages on a monthly or quarterly basis. It’s important to work closely with your provider to ensure that the rotating plan offers scalability, reliability, and the ability to quickly adjust services as your business grows or faces seasonal fluctuations.

5. Set Up Automated Service Adjustments

To ensure that your rotating ISP plan is seamlessly integrated into your business operations, it's important to set up automated adjustments for switching between service levels. Many ISPs offer cloud-based platforms that enable businesses to automatically scale their internet service up or down based on pre-set criteria. These adjustments can be set to occur at specific times or when certain thresholds are met, such as when traffic exceeds a certain level or when bandwidth usage reaches a predefined cap. Automation simplifies the process and ensures that your ISP plan adapts in real time without manual intervention.

6. Monitor and Optimize Regularly

Once your rotating ISP plan is in place, continuous monitoring and optimization are key to ensuring that the plan continues to meet your business needs. Regularly reviewing internet usage reports and analyzing performance data will help you identify areas for improvement and fine-tune your plan. For instance, if certain periods consistently require more bandwidth than expected, you can adjust your plan to accommodate this trend. Monitoring also allows businesses to stay ahead of any performance issues and ensures that the rotating plan delivers the desired outcomes without unexpected disruptions.

Benefits of Rotating ISP Plans for Businesses

The main benefits of rotating ISP plans for businesses include cost savings, flexibility, and enhanced service reliability. Here’s a closer look at each of these benefits:

1. Cost Savings: As businesses only pay for the bandwidth and services they need, they can significantly reduce unnecessary costs. By customizing plans to meet the dynamic needs of their operations, businesses avoid paying for services that are underutilized during low-demand periods.

2. Flexibility: Customizable ISP plans offer businesses the flexibility to scale their service up or down as needed. This adaptability is ideal for businesses with fluctuating internet needs, such as seasonal demand, remote work, or high-traffic events.

3. Improved Reliability: With rotating ISP plans, businesses ensure that they have the right resources available at the right time. This leads to better service reliability, fewer disruptions, and improved customer experience, all of which contribute to business success.

In conclusion, customizing a rotating ISP plan based on specific business needs is an effective strategy for optimizing internet services while reducing costs. By assessing internet usage patterns, identifying peak and off-peak hours, understanding department-specific requirements, and working with an ISP to develop a tailored plan, businesses can maximize their internet performance and minimize wasteful spending. Rotating ISP plans offer the flexibility, scalability, and cost efficiency necessary for businesses to stay competitive in today’s fast-paced digital world.
